San Antonio Independent School District Kodály Training

 Program Administrator: Ann Burbridge (SAISD)

Instructors – Pedagogy & Folk Song Research: Carol Wheeler (Lubbock), Karen Gentry (Austin)

Instructor – Solfege/Musicianship:  Paul Rauschhuber (San Antonio)

Instructors – Choir and Conducting: Dr. Gary Mabry (UTSA), Barbara Murphy-Frank (San Antonio), Becky Terrazas (NISD, ret.), Ann Burbridge (SAISD)

Instructor - Recorder Dr. Susan Bruenger (UTSA)

Instructor – Dulcimer: David Hightower (San Antonio)

 The Kodály training in SAISD has been operational for 5 years. Our second class of Level III students will graduate on June 11. We are delighted to provide 15 days of training spread out over 1 year. Our teachers like the fact that they have time to implement new training/strategies in-between classes.
